It makes sense. We have the Volkihar, the paranoid and cruel vampires who only go out to feed. They can easily be identified as savage and barbaric, the worst type of vampire in the eyes of the Cyrodilic Order of vampires. And the Order has a nasty reputation of being extremely competitive and merciless when it comes to dealing with rival tribes. We all know this from the books and lore. No doubt Janus Hassildor was on of these vampires, his dialogue matches what is written in the tenets of these vampires.

I don't know, but I have reason to believe they may return. SInce it's no longer the third era, they may want to make a new place of operations, or their "Stronghold" in the fourth era. Perhaps expand their territory and try to take over Skyrim as the leading vampire clan. In order to do that they would have to eradicate all other competitors, something we have read in "Immortal Blood". It would be great to see a show off between the Volkihar and the Order. Barbaric bloodsvcking monsters vs civilized bloodsvckers.
